DESCRIPTION:No. 78009
Mineral:Calcite
Locality:road construction, Route 360 at Bee Cave Road, Austin, Travis County, Texas
Description:Sparkling cluster of lustrous transparent colorless calcite crystals with remnants of gray limestone on the bottom. The calcite crystals are short hexagonal prisms, with three-faced rhombohedral terminations. Originally acquired in November 1993
Overall Size:28x20x17 mm
Crystals:3-7 mm
